Dongchuan Red Land

Dongchuan Red Land is both the creation of nature and human beings. It refers to red arable land with a radius of nearly one hundred miles around Huashitou village in Dongchuan District,220 kilometers north of Kunming city. The land here, because there is more iron in the soil, and the iron is slowly deposited by oxidation to form a dazzling red.

After countless years of hard work, the locals planted green crops on red land, and these crops produced colorful flowers and golden fruits, plus pure blue sky and changing clouds to constitute the spectacular natural and human landscape of the Red Land.

The best time to have a photography tour is from May to September, October to November. After December, Dongchuan in snow weather would show a world wrapped in silver, but roads may be blocked due to the frozen days. If at the right time, Luoxiagou, Luositian, Jinxiuyuan, and Damakan are the best spots to get outstanding pictures.
